COMMUNITY IMPACT COORDINATOR

YMCA of Central New York

Job Title: Community Impact Coordinator

Reports to: Vice President of Marketing and Communications

Work Location: Association Office, Syracuse, NY

FLSA: Non-exempt – Full-Time

Work Schedule: Monday through Friday, events as necessary

Salary Range: $20.00/hour

Position Summary:

This position supports the work of the Y, a leading nonprofit, charitable organization committed to strengthening community through youth development, healthy living, and social responsibility. The communication efforts of the YMCA are imperative to every department, raising awareness about our programming to support funding and community engagement efforts.

Salary and Benefits:

Salary: $20.00/hour, Full-time non-exempt

YMCA Family Membership

YMCA Retirement Fund Contribution: 12% (Y-10%; employee-2%)

Health Insurance (2 plans with significant employer contribution for employee’s premium)

Personal Time, Vacation, New York State Paid Sick Leave, and 12 Paid Holidays

Essential Functions:

Support the development of and implementation of strategies to promote community engagement and fundraising.

Assist in developing content for use across platforms (social media, newsletters, website, digital screens) and promotional materials that aligns with the Y brand and community impact efforts.

Manage the YMCACNY social media calendar through inputting post plans and key events as well as supporting day-to-day posting and engagement.

Collect and analyze data across Y platforms (Daxko Engage, social media, etc) to amplify impact.

Support the production of promotional videos, photographs, Y stories, and content into the Y’s communication platforms.

Assist with coordination of MarComm project management, including monitoring department email and working within Asana.

Attend Y-USA webinars & trainings as needed.

Work cooperatively with all staff, including attendance in staff meetings to gain a better understanding of the Y’s marketing and communications strategy.

Support association events that amplify the cause and impact of the organization.

Support overall donor engagement and stewardship processes to increase connection to cause and impact.

All other duties as assigned.

Experience, Education, and Qualifications

Have an Associate’s degree or equivalent in business or marketing.

Have at least 1-year relevant experience.

Excellent verbal and written communication skills.

Deep understanding of digital and social media platforms.

Ability to relate effectively to diverse groups of people from all social and economic segments of the community.

Design/photography/video editing skills and familiarity with Adobe Creative Cloud and/or Canva a plus.

Strong relationship builder with excellent interpersonal and communication skills.

Ability to perform quality work within given deadlines and expectations with or without direct supervision.

Able to serve effectively as a team contributor on all assignments, and able to work independently while understanding the necessity for communication and coordination.

Able to attend meetings and training as required.
